Ars Vivendi Fellowship (Spring 2026)


The Collegium Institute invites you to apply for this Spring’s Fellowship program exploring art, philosophy, and the transcendent: Art is For Living. The program will welcome a small cohort of student fellows each semester to participate in a seven-session dinner discussion series held at the University of Pennsylvania, including a capstone museum trip and workshop.

The discussions will be facilitated by artists, philosophers, and other thinkers who seek to explore the heart of craft, beauty and making with an attunement to their philosophical and theological underpinnings. Among the questions to be raised are: What is art? Why do we make? What is the responsibility of the artist? What is the relationship between beauty, truth, & justice? Between creativity and the divine? What is the place of ritual and routine?
